Including interesting features in the new Collaboration Portal

 


The majority of Internet users are getting very familiar in working with Web 2.0 technologies to customize their user interfaces. With the usage of Ajax SAP provides for the users of the collaboration portal a new UI. This UI is similar to the experience, which most of the web users already have and due to this reason they can create easy their own work environment very quickly and intuitive. The delivered features offer a lot of creative work. Only the iView integration itself makes a lot of tools available in the collaboration workspace, e.g. URL iViews, a Web Dynpro Application, R3 Application, etc. Working with the Collaboration Portal we have included some interesting features, which I would like to present here:

Google Integration - Google is already an established Web 2.0 leader on the web. The collaboration portal itself is based on the Google Web Toolkit. This means it will be possible to make those two great solutions work together. For this reason we have integrated Google Gadgets as iParts in the Collaboration Portal. The integration of the Gadgets can be done very easy using an URL iView, which has same modified properties. The Link in the URL iView is the HTML Code for embedding a Gadget in a website.




 
 
Afterwards an iPart template has to be created by using:

  • Portal Application: com.sap.portal.coll.iViewProxyIPart
  • Portal Component: IViewProxyComponent

After that the iPart template (iView) has to be open for editing, and set the following properties in the Property Editor:

  •  iView to Expose: The PCD address of the URL iView to display in the iPart
  •  iView Properties to Expose: A set of iView properties to expose in the iPart

The iParts based on Gadgets offer very useful functions like Google Talk for quick communication, translation e.g. Leo, Wikipedia, Deutsche Bahn, etc. The functions based on the Gadgets are organised in several Pages, which provides a good workspace overview. The result looks like:


 

Enter labels to add to this page:
Please wait 
Looking for a label? Just start typing.